What is a Spinal Pelvic Stabilizer? A Spinal Pelvic Stabilizer is an insert placed in your shoe to help improve your body's balance, posture, and alignment. Stabilizers are the only orthotics designed to support all three arches of the foot. By providing proper support to your feet, Stabilizers help create a balanced foundation for your body. Custom-made: From a weight-bearing foam cast or digital scan of your feet, Foot Levelers' technicians take sixteen exact measurements to create your pair of custom-made Stabilizers. Your lifestyle, age, weight, activity level, and condition are also considered in their creation. They're Unique - Just Like You. Why do I need Stabilizers? Contrary to popular belief, many people with foot problems experience little or no pain in their feet. Instead, the pain is transferred to other areas of your body. Your feet are the foundation for your entire body, and having proper posture is the best way to support your body. If you have weakness or unstable positioning in either foot, it can contribute to postural problems throughout the rest of your body. By balancing your feet, Stabilizers help improve your posture, enhance your body's performance and efficiency, reduce pain, and contribute to your total body wellness.
